What to check before choosing a building with low open violation rates near the BX42 bus in Throgs Neck

  • Confirm what “low open violations” means for the building by checking the Openigloo signal details and then asking management what’s currently open, fixed, or scheduled.
  • Use the BX42 bus proximity to streamline your commute: double-check the exact walking route and time at the hours you’d actually travel.
  • Treat building-level signals as context, not a guarantee: ask about current maintenance response times and how they handle recurring issues.
  • Before signing, review full move-in costs (security deposit and any required fees) and ask about any restrictions that could affect your tenancy or scheduling.
  • Cross-check the building’s policies and any management practices mentioned in tenant Q&A, since experience can vary unit to unit.
